For more than a quarter century, author Neal Lozano has brought the liberating message of "Unbound ministry" worldwide. His book Unbound: A Practical Guide to Deliverance was originally published in 2003 and has been translated into 22 languages, with nearly 400,000 copies in print. At live events, hundreds of trained teams have fruitfully ministered the Unbound model of deliverance in churches and conferences far and wide — not only at public gatherings, but through priest conferences, online training courses, individual Unbound sessions, speaking engagements, podcasts, and other media presentations.
The Unbound Unpacked e-book was born after Neal Lozano received an invitation to speak in 2024 at a gathering in Rome entitled "The Course on the Ministry of Exorcism and Deliverance." Since 2004, the Course has been sponsored annually by Institute Sacerdos, open to clergy, priests, and diocesan-approved laity involved in the ministry of exorcism and deliverance. The author's two talks in Rome — "Unbound: A Non-Confrontational Approach to Deliverance" and "Unbound Principles and Practices" — were well received by the 200 attendees from nearly 50 nations gathered in the Eternal City.
Now, Neal's two-part presentation in Rome has been published for a wider audience, with online resources provided for further exploration.
